Output e8772a8a21e74d7c14f8f3c084fd749671ef806c96dda735f4caad1c613c7335:3

value
593996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5a771c39e8f3d9e90835d846df130a990144174 OP_EQUAL
address
3NdKFiKPdKcws17ypqcNGPgJAqfaAAdh4F
transaction
e8772a8a21e74d7c14f8f3c084fd749671ef806c96dda735f4caad1c613c7335